In this paper, the stability problem of delayed quaternion-valued singular systems with Markov switching is investigated. By constructing an appropriate Lyapunov-Krasovskii functional and employing matrix inequality techniques, sufficient conditions are derived in the form of quaternion-valued linear matrix inequalities to ensure the stability of the closed-loop system, and the state feedback controller is designed. Two illustrative examples and corresponding simulations are also provided to verify the effectiveness of the proposed theoretical results.
